
PicFinder 是一款功能强大的图像搜索引擎,它通过利用最先进的人工智能和计算机视觉技术,为用户提供准确且高效的图像搜索体验。本文将深入探讨 PicFinder 的内部技术和工作原理,揭示它如何利用尖端技术来满足您的图像搜索需求。
图像特征提取
PicFinder 的第一个关键技术步骤是图像特征提取。这一过程涉及分析图像并识别其独特的特征,例如形状、纹理、颜色和边缘。这些特征被提取并存储在称为特征向量的数学结构中。通过提取图像的特征,PicFinder 可以创建一种数字表示,用于图像搜索和匹配。
索引和搜索
PicFinder 使用高效的索引和搜索算法来组织和处理庞大的图像数据库。当用户搜索图像时,他们的查询会转换为一个特征向量。该向量与存储在索引中的所有图像特征向量进行比较。此过程会返回与查询最相关的图像,按照相似性排序。
图像分类和标签化
除了搜索外,PicFinder 还利用机器学习技术来分类和标记图像。通过分析图像的特征,PicFinder 可以自动将它们分配到不同的类别,例如动物、人物、风景或物体。此分类过程使 PicFinder 能够提供更加精细和相关的搜索结果。
深度学习神经网络
PicFinder 依赖于深度学习神经网络,这是一类强大的机器学习模型。这些神经网络接受了海量图像数据集的训练,学习识别图像中高级别特征。通过使用神经网络,PicFinder 可以准确地提取图像特征,并生成与查询高度相关的搜索结果。
计算机视觉算法
除了神经网络外,PicFinder 还利用各种计算机视觉算法来增强其图像处理能力。这些算法执行任务,例如图像分割、目标检测和特征匹配。通过组合这些算法,PicFinder 可以分析复杂图像,并从中提取有意义的信息。
分布式系统和可扩展性
为了处理庞大的图像数据库和大量的搜索请求,PicFinder 采用了分布式系统架构。此架构将任务分散在多个服务器上,从而提高处理速度和可扩展性。通过利用云计算平台,PicFinder 可以根据需要动态地扩展其基础设施,以满足不断增长的需求。
用户体验
PicFinder 的技术能力最终以用户友好的界面呈现。用户可以通过简单的关键字搜索或图像上传进行搜索。搜索结果清晰地呈现,并提供与查询相关的图像。PicFinder 提供高级搜索选项,例如颜色过滤、尺寸限制和相似图像搜索,以进一步优化搜索结果。
不断发展和创新
PicFinder 作为一个不断发展的平台,始终致力于创新,以提高其图像搜索功能。研究团队积极探索新技术,例如迁移学习、弱监督学习和知识图谱,以增强 PicFinder 的准确性和效率。通过持续的创新,PicFinder 旨在提供无与伦比的图像搜索体验,满足不断变化的图像搜索需求。
结语
PicFinder 的技术和工作原理融合了人工智能、计算机视觉和分布式系统的力量。通过图像特征提取、索引和搜索、图像分类和标签化以及强大的计算机视觉算法,PicFinder 提供了准确、高效且用户友好的图像搜索体验。随着其不断发展和创新,PicFinder 将继续引领图像搜索领域的变革,为用户提供无与伦比的图像搜索解决方案。

